Diagnostic Accuracy of Formative Assessments and Optimal Cutoff Scores for Prediction of High-Stakes Assessment

Abstract

Despite current legislation, students continue to struggle with attainment of statewide academic standards as measured by high-stakes assessment. The purpose of the current study was to examine the relationship between DIBELS ORF, AIMSweb Maze-CBM, and the North Carolina End-of Grade (EOG) Assessment of Reading Comprehension. The study investigated the diagnostic accuracy of established cutoff scores and determined optimal cutoff scores. Participants included 336 students in third, fourth, and fifth grades. Results of the study indicated a significant relationship between the measures. Receiver Operating Characteristic (ROC) Curves revealed statistically significant Area Under the Curve (AUC) values for ORF and Maze. Optimal cutoff scores to maximize sensitivity and specificity yielded slightly different cutoff points for ORF and Maze.
